Texas Tech University Health Sciences Center (TTUHSC), a premier institution for health-related education, considers various factors during the admissions process, including standardized test scores like the SAT for certain programs. While TTUHSC primarily focuses on undergraduate and graduate health science programs, SAT scores may be relevant for specific pathways or combined degree programs that require an undergraduate foundation. For prospective students, understanding the role of SAT scores in the admissions process at Texas Tech University Health Sciences Center is crucial, as it can influence preparation and application strategies. The university aims to admit well-rounded candidates who demonstrate academic excellence, and SAT scores can serve as one indicator of readiness for rigorous health science curricula.

SAT Score Ranges for Admitted Students:

  • Score Range: 1180–1380 (based on historical data for competitive programs at TTUHSC)
  • Average Score: Approximately 1280, reflecting the midpoint of admitted students
  • 75th Percentile: Around 1380, indicating the top tier of scores among accepted applicants

Key Points:

  • SAT or ACT scores are not universally required for all programs at Texas Tech University Health Sciences Center; requirements vary by specific school or degree track.
  • Scores are evaluated as part of a holistic review process, alongside GPA, extracurriculars, and relevant experience in health sciences.
  • TTUHSC may superscore SAT results for some programs, combining the highest section scores from multiple test dates to create the best possible composite score.
  • Alternatives such as AP or IB test scores may be considered for placement or credit, though they do not typically replace SAT requirements when applicable.
  • Applicants aiming for competitive programs at TTUHSC are encouraged to target scores above the 75th percentile (1380+) to strengthen their applications.
